The strength and courage it takes to share our experiences is a beautiful and sacred part of humanity. As a trauma therapist, Vanessa's passion is to help individuals express, embrace and empower their true selves. By processing trauma, we have the opportunity to break free from shame, guilt, fear and resistance. Using a holistic approach to connect to the mind, body and soul, she believes that the root of our pain is also the source of where our healing begins. After all, knowing yourself is the beginning of all wisdom (Aristotle) and until you make the unconscious conscious, it will direct your life and you will call fate (Jung). In addition to being a licensed CMHC, Vanessa is also a Certified Clinical Trauma Professional (CCTP). She has completed advanced trainings and certifications in neuroscience and integrative health. Her eight years in the mental health field include case management, life coaching, spiritual counseling, nutritional psychology and crisis work. She is in her final year of her PhD Psychology program and holds a Master of Science in Clinical Mental Health Counseling. Most of her experience consists of working with individuals who have struggled with: psychological, physical and sexual abuse burnout, perfectionism and work-life balance dissociation, disassociation and depersonalization religious, cultural and generational trauma grief and bereavement chronic stress, insomnia and health concerns

What should a new client know about working with you?

Vanessa's eclectic approach is inquisitive and empowering. She helps you understand the elements of the mind, body and soul. This way you can learn about the unique make up of your whole self and how these elements manifest in your life, mindset and health. To master the mind, Vanessa utilizes EMDR, Accelerated Resolution Therapy (ART), Polyvagal and TFCBT. To honor the body, her eclectic approach includes somatic work and Nutritional Psychology (NP). To awaken the soul, she draws from humanistic, psychodynamic and strength-based interventions by combining shadow work, inner child healing and self-exploration.

What is your typical process for working with clients?

In our first session, we do an intake where we will focus on gathering information based on your background, health and history. Most importantly, we will explore what your goals and expectations for treatment are, as well as any questions or concerns you have about the process. I develop tailored treatment plans based on individual needs, goals and aspirations. This way I can draw from the interests and values of my clients.
